Discover the historic steam locomotive CN 2747 at Rotary Heritage Park during our Open Gate hours, weather permitting. Museum staff and volunteers will be available to assist visitors with any questions.
CN 2747 is located at Rotary Heritage Park, 735 Kildare Avenue West. The park is accessible from Plessis Road, north of Kildare Avenue West/Transcona Boulevard. There is a parking lot near the Transcona Trail, but please note that space is limited.
The CN 2747 enclosure is accessible for those with wheelchairs, walkers, and strollers via paved and gravel footpaths in Rotary Heritage Park. A concrete pad surrounds the locomotive within the enclosure, allowing visitors to view it up close. Access to the locomotive’s cab is via a single staircase; however, visitors are not permitted to walk or climb onto other sections of CN 2747 or the enclosure structure.
Please be aware that there are no public washrooms available in Rotary Heritage Park. Washrooms can be found at the Transcona Library, located directly across the street.
